Buffy has been free since day one. It's going to stay that way for personal use.
But over the past few months, a pattern has emerged: power users are hitting limits, teams want shared routines, and developers want higher API quotas. We've been quietly noting every "can I get more channels?" and "is there a team plan?" that's come in.
So: Buffy Pro is coming.
What stays free
Everything on the current plan stays free, permanently:
- Up to 25 active habits
- Up to 100 active tasks
- Up to 15 routines
- Up to 200 reminders/day
- 365 days of memory with personalization
- Up to 3 linked channels (ChatGPT, Telegram, Slack/Clawbot)
- Advanced scheduling, AI intent parsing, daily briefing
If you're a single person running your habits and routines, the free tier covers you completely. This isn't a "free trial" — it's the permanent free plan.
What Pro will add
We're still finalizing the details, but the shape is clear from what users are asking for:
- Higher activity limits — more habits, tasks, and routines for people running complex systems
- More channels — link all your surfaces without hitting the channel cap
- Extended memory window — deeper behavioral history for better adaptation
- Team and workspace features — shared routines in Slack, participation tracking, workspace-level billing
- Priority reminder delivery — for when timing actually matters
